Packing Light for Spring Break

Packing light is an art that can significantly enhance your spring break experience. By minimizing your luggage, you'll enjoy greater mobility and avoid excess baggage fees.

Start by creating a packing list focused on versatile clothing items that can be mixed and matched. Choose lightweight, quick-drying fabrics that are suitable for your destination's climate.

Roll your clothes instead of folding them to save space and reduce wrinkles. Use packing cubes or compression bags to organize and compact your belongings further.

Don't forget to leave some room in your luggage for souvenirs or unexpected purchases. Remember, you can always do laundry during your trip if needed.

Choosing Safe Accommodations

Selecting the right accommodation is crucial for a safe and enjoyable spring break. Research your options thoroughly before making a reservation.

Look for properties with positive reviews from recent travelers, focusing on comments about safety, cleanliness, and location. Check if the accommodation has 24-hour security or a front desk for added peace of mind.

Consider the neighborhood's safety and proximity to attractions or public transportation. If you're staying in a vacation rental, ensure it's through a reputable platform with verified listings.

Don't hesitate to contact the property directly with any questions or concerns. A responsive and helpful staff is often a good indicator of a well-managed establishment.

Staying Aware of Surroundings

Maintaining awareness of your surroundings is crucial for a safe spring break experience. This skill can help you avoid potential dangers and fully enjoy your trip.

When exploring new areas, stay alert and trust your instincts. If a situation feels uncomfortable, it's best to remove yourself from it. Avoid walking alone at night, especially in unfamiliar locations.

Keep an eye on your belongings at all times, particularly in crowded tourist areas. Be cautious when using public Wi-Fi networks, as they can be vulnerable to security breaches.

Learn a few key phrases in the local language if traveling abroad. This can help you communicate in case of emergencies or when seeking assistance.

Protecting Your Valuables

Safeguarding your valuables is essential to prevent theft and ensure a stress-free vacation. Take proactive measures to protect your belongings throughout your trip.

Use the hotel safe or a portable travel safe to store important documents, excess cash, and valuable items when you're not carrying them. Consider using RFID-blocking wallets to protect your credit cards from electronic pickpocketing.

Avoid displaying expensive jewelry or electronics in public. When possible, use a crossbody bag or money belt to keep your essentials close and secure.

Make digital copies of important documents like your passport and store them securely online. This can be a lifesaver if your physical documents are lost or stolen.

Emergency Contacts and Plans

Having a solid emergency plan in place can provide peace of mind and crucial support if unexpected situations arise during your spring break travels.

Before your trip, create a list of emergency contacts including local embassy or consulate information, your travel insurance provider's assistance hotline, and trusted family or friends back home.

Research the local emergency services numbers for your destination. Save these contacts in your phone and write them down on a card to keep in your wallet.

Share your itinerary and accommodation details with a trusted person at home. Establish regular check-in times to keep them informed of your whereabouts and well-being.

Consider using a travel safety app that can provide real-time alerts and emergency assistance if needed.

Reasons to Buy Travel Insurance

Purchasing travel insurance is a wise decision that can save you from significant financial losses and provide peace of mind during your spring break adventure.

Travel insurance protects you against trip cancellations or interruptions due to unforeseen events such as illness, severe weather, or travel provider bankruptcies. This coverage can reimburse you for non-refundable expenses.

Medical emergencies abroad can be extremely costly. Travel insurance with medical coverage can help cover expenses for treatment, hospitalization, and even emergency medical evacuation if necessary.

Lost or delayed baggage, flight delays, and missed connections are common travel mishaps. Travel insurance can provide compensation for these inconveniences, helping you manage unexpected expenses.

Comparing Travel Insurance Plans

When selecting a travel insurance plan, it's important to compare different options to find the best coverage for your specific needs and budget.

Start by assessing your trip details, including destination, duration, and planned activities. This information will help you determine the types of coverage you require.

Use comparison tools to evaluate plans from multiple providers side by side. Look at coverage limits, deductibles, and exclusions for each policy.

Pay attention to specific benefits that may be important for your trip, such as adventure sports coverage or Cancel for Any Reason (CFAR) options.

Read customer reviews and check the insurance provider's reputation for customer service and claim processing efficiency.

Benefits of Travel Insurance Coverage

Travel insurance offers a wide range of benefits that can protect you financially and provide assistance during your spring break trip.

Trip Cancellation and Interruption Coverage: This benefit reimburses you for pre-paid, non-refundable expenses if you need to cancel or cut short your trip due to covered reasons.

Emergency Medical Coverage: This can cover medical expenses incurred during your trip, including hospital stays, doctor visits, and prescription medications.

Baggage Protection: If your luggage is lost, damaged, or delayed, travel insurance can provide compensation to help you replace essential items.

24/7 Travel Assistance: Many travel insurance plans offer round-the-clock support services, helping you with everything from finding local medical care to replacing lost travel documents.
